What’s proposed
Permission on a site (approx. 0.194 Ha) in the townland of Gollierstown, Adamstown, Lucan, Co. Dublin on lands generally bounded by Adamstown Avenue to the north and north-east, to the west by the Civic Plaza, to the south and south-east by lands located within Development Area 11- Adamstown Station (subject to concurrent planning application SDCC Reg. Ref. SDZ25A/0050W). The proposed development comprises a 5-storey civic building accommodating library (c. 1,606.0sqm) and enterprise (c. 1,505.0sqm) uses; all associated site development and landscape works, including provision of bicycle parking; plant at roof level; adjustments to Adamstown Avenue including provision of active travel infrastructure, including a bus stop, bus shelter and a loading bay on the south side of the road. This application is being made in accordance with the Adamstown Planning Scheme 2014, as amended, and relates to a proposed development within the Adamstown Strategic Development Zone Planning Scheme Area, as defined by Statutory Instrument No. 272 of 2001
SDZ26A/0003W is a planning application to South Dublin County Council for permission on a site (approx. 0.194 Ha) in the townland of Gollierstown, Adamstown, received on 22 Jan 2026; permission was granted on 18 Mar 2026.
